This autumn, explore the chilling universe crafted by Shirley Jackson through an anthology that showcases her most gripping and eerie short stories, highlighting her as the reigning figure of American gothic literature. The calm façade of suburban life conceals sinister undercurrents in these enthralling narratives. A routine commute unexpectedly transforms into a terrifying pursuit, a seemingly gentle homemaker nurtures dark, lethal fantasies, and a person regarded as a responsible citizen might, in fact, be a notorious serial murderer. Shirley Jackson masterfully weaves an eerie setting where appearances are deceiving and no place offers true safety, whether it be the bustling city streets, a remote country estate, a modest town apartment, or the ominous depths of the forest. The collection features such unforgettable stories as 'The Possibility of Evil', 'Louisa, Please Come Home', 'Paranoia', 'The Honeymoon of Mrs Smith', 'The Story We Used to Tell', 'The Sorcerer's Apprentice', 'Jack the Ripper', 'The Beautiful Stranger', 'All She Said Was Yes', 'What a Thought', 'The Bus', 'Family Treasures', 'A Visit', 'The Good Wife', 'The Man in the Woods', 'Home', and 'The Summer People'.
